Handover note — Crumbwheel order cutoffs.

Welcome aboard. The bakery cutoff rule in Crumbwheel closes same-day orders at 14:00 local to each storefront, not UTC — this has bitten us twice. Holiday overrides live in the calendar service and take precedence silently, so always check there first when a cutoff looks wrong. To unlock the calendar service's admin console after a restart, enter the recovery passphrase below.

vault phrase of bagap-bahaf = silion-pelox-sorox-casdor-quenwyn-fraax-eliox-praael-kelion-quenvan-kasox-rusael-norius-belvan

Minutes — Management Meeting, Insurance Renewal

Attending: P. Nwosu, H. Calderbank, S. Imrie.

The combined liability policy for all Ferrowood branches expires next quarter. Two quotations reviewed in detail; the Meridane Mutual proposal offers broader flood cover at comparable premium. Branch managers must submit updated asset registers within ten working days. Calderbank will negotiate final terms. The confidential note on related plans follows below.

confidential, fajop-fajef: Soriusax Foods plans to lower the Rusix list price by 43.2 percent in December. The steering committee signed off on a budget of $74.0 million for Project Oliion. The renewal with Brivanix Works closes at $118.6 million a year, 43.4 percent above the last contract. Project Ulaiel slips by six weeks because of the audit delay.

New starter checklist — Tallowbridge Group

☐ Secure interview room (Room 4B): book a 20-minute slot for the starter's right-to-work check on day one. The room self-locks, so arrive first and prop nothing in the door. Entry is via the keypad, using the code below.

staff pass of kawip-hawef = bdg-QLP-2